How representative fees work: Disability representatives are paid from your back pay — typically 25% of past-due benefits, capped at $7,200 (2026 limit). This fee is set by federal law, not by the representative. If you don't win, you don't pay anything.

How long does the disability process take?

It varies. Initial applications typically take 3-6 months. If denied, an appeal hearing can take 12-18 months. That's one reason we help people build the strongest possible case from the start — to maximize the chances of approval at the initial level.
